Can make this thing works.
I updated the forza settings with 

127.0.0.1

port 1001

but no connection with Simhub.

I also tried:

1. disable firewall

2. change port

3. change ip to 192.168.1.*(my local ip)

4. open udp ports on firewall

5. AppContainer Loopback show "Failed to get appContainer"

What else I can do?

Actually store games are "protected" by windows and can't communicate with the local computer (yes it's strange, it can communicate with the whole world over internet/network, but not to your own computer Oo). That's why the loopback exception step is mandatory, it unblocks these local communication which allows simhub to receive the data on the same computer. Otherwise the game sends the telemetry, windows block it and so simhub can't receive it.
Reinstalling is far from ideal, but unfortunately there is no documented solutions to solve that windows issue at my knowledge.

No unfortunately it's not related,

However I may have found a way,
It looks like adding the exception using command line could work even when windows is messing up :

CheckNetIsolation LoopbackExempt -a -n="S-1-15-2-1408466000-1616203321-337581629-199271302-1885606354-1487447307-2757409382"
CheckNetIsolation LoopbackExempt -a -n="S-1-15-2-4229748693-3326341846-1495081741-1528692508-1131203849-336638721-4261848658"

I cant remember which sid is the one for horizon or motorsport so I added both, could you give a try ? You will have to run the commands using command line (or powershell) and running as administrator.

I've attached a zip file containing the commands as a bat file, simply unzip it and right click to run as administrator.
As always when running any random .bat do not hesitate to edit it and read it first, mine is not harmful, but it's a good reflex to know what you are running on your computer :D, even more when it's as administrator 😀

Yeah xbox to PC does not suffer from this restriction, only windows store app sending data on the same pc, you can even make it work from pc to another pc without encountering this limitation neither.

Indeed in the early days of forza support (when nobody still figured this exemption solution ... when it works) the first solutions which appeared were to route the traffic using an udp repeater or using a nat translation sending data over internet and letting the router resend it to the computer. In short really bulky solutions 🙁 and requiring a good technical level.
